An Account of a Fire-Ball, Seen at Hornsey, by William Hirst (1753)

Monday 9 April 2012 at 16:06


An Account of a Fire-Ball, Seen at Hornsey, by William Hirst, F. R. S. Communicated in a Letter to Samuel Mead, Esq; F. R. S Hirst, in the Philosophical Transactions of the Royal Society Vol. 48 Pg 773–776; 1753; Royal Society of London, London

“I was then going down the hill adjoining to the south side of Hornsey-church, and was not a little surprised to find myself suddenly surrounded by a light equal to that of the full moon, though the moon (which was then four days old) had been set about fifty minutes.”
